OUR SHARED VALUES

Truth as the Trunk of a Mighty Tree

To value truth is like standing at the trunk of a mighty tree: from that strong center, all the necessary values for a balanced and harmonious community naturally branch out.

Yet, as we discover and practice this truth, it helps to consciously nurture those branches — recognizing them as living expressions that support and sustain the whole.

Truth & Love

There is a Universal Truth — an eternal, unchanging reality that transcends time, perception, and individual experience. Personal truth, shaped by our emotions, thoughts, and perceptions, branches from this eternal truth, serving as a gateway to deeper understanding. By exploring what feels true in the moment with honesty and curiosity, we refine our awareness and move closer to what is ultimately real. We can trace these branches back, reexamining and remembering where we come from, reconnecting to the source of our truth. Love is the embodiment of truth in action, expressed through compassion, acceptance, and reverence for all beings. To seek truth is to seek love, and to act in love is to align with the deepest truth of oneness.

Sovereignty & Interdependence

Every being is a free, sovereign expression of the Divine, holding the innate responsibility to walk their unique path. With this freedom comes the quiet awareness that we are all interconnected — our choices ripple outward, touching and shaping the world around us. True sovereignty isn’t about standing apart, but about consciously participating in the greater whole, where each individual’s freedom supports the flourishing of all. In this shared flow, mutual support creates the space for both individuals and communities to thrive, growing together in harmony.

Wisdom & Innocence

Wisdom sprouts from lived experience, reflection, and integration of truth. It is the capacity to discern with clarity and act from deep knowing and boundless compassion. Innocence is residing in our innate goodness which allows us to function unburdened by assumptions or rigid conclusions. It invites playful curiosity and openness to experiencing life with fresh eyes. To embody both is to hold the balance of depth and play, knowledge and wonder, mastery and the willingness to be a beginner.

Discipline & Surrender

Discipline is the dedication to practice, refinement, and intentional action — it is the structure that allows growth and mastery. Surrender is the ability to trust, let go, and flow with the organic unfolding of life. Stemming from our innate fullness, it is an expression of effortless action. True creation, transformation, and harmony arise when both are honoured: the disciplined devotion to what is meaningful, and the surrender to forces greater than ourselves.

Expression & Listening

Expression is the sharing of inner truth — through words, art, movement, or any creative form. It is a natural unfurling, a spring that overflows from the earth, spontaneous, unconditioned, and potent. It is the act of bringing forth one’s unique perspective, emotions, and insights. Listening, in contrast, is the stillness required to truly receive, understand, and integrate what is being communicated — whether by others, by life itself, or by the deeper wisdom within. True communication flourishes in the balance between expression and listening, ensuring that truth is not only shared but also deeply honoured in our relationships. Yet words, by their nature, are imperfect. They can only gesture toward the depth of what we mean to convey. In silence, we anchor ourselves beyond language, becoming true witnesses to the connection we share.

Power & Humility

Power is the fearless alignment with truth — the ability to create, influence, and transform through integrity, wisdom, and service. Humility is an honest acknowledgment of one's place within the greater whole — neither above nor below, but in shared existence with all beings. True humility allows one to move through life with openness, curiosity, and a willingness to learn, free from the illusion of superiority or separateness. True power is not exercised through control, but through service. True humility does not diminish — it honours the sacredness in all.

Presence & Vision

Presence is the practice of being fully here, now — aware, embodied, and attuned to the richness of this moment. Vision is the ability to dream, to see beyond the present, and to create with intention toward the future. When presence and vision work in harmony, we move with clarity and grace, grounded in the now while shaping what is to come.
